The activity of Vanadium pentoxide supported on silicagel for the photocatalytic oxidation of cyclohexane has been studied. It was found that this catalyst presents a stable activity after an or decrease depending on the surface concentration of VOshrd initial unsteady state period during which the activity might increase or decrease depending on the surface concentration of V 2 O 5 . An interpretation is proposed for the two phenomena affecting the activity during the unsteady state period.
